操作系统您现在的位置是:首页 > 博客日志 > 操作系统

如何通过注册表为指定扩展名的文件添加右键菜单?

<a href='mailto:'>微wx笑</a>的头像微wx笑 2023-01-23操作系统 0 0关键字: 注册表  右键菜单  

当你在不同扩展名的文件上点击鼠标右键的时候,看到的是不同的菜单,操作系统真的这么智能吗?知道每一种文件应该如何处理?其实它是通过注册表才知道如何处理的。这里就介绍一下:如何通过注册表为指定扩展名的文件添加右键菜单?

当你在不同扩展名的文件上点击鼠标右键的时候,看到的是不同的菜单,操作系统真的这么智能吗?知道每一种文件应该如何处理?其实它是通过注册表才知道如何处理的。这里就介绍一下:如何通过注册表为指定扩展名的文件添加右键菜单?aJh无知


aJh无知

前面写过一篇:如何通过注册表为文件(夹)添加右键菜单?aJh无知

今天再写一下 为指定扩展名的文件添加右键菜单,我在实际应用中的心得。aJh无知

尝试为指定扩展名的文件添加右键菜单,直接在aJh无知

HKEY_CLASSES_ROOT\文件扩展名\aJh无知

下创建 shell 项,添加相关的菜单项是没有用的!aJh无知

需要通过 OpenWithProgids 项来解决。aJh无知

比如 .js 扩展名的js脚本文件,打开注册表aJh无知

找到 HKEY_CLASSES_ROOT\.js,在 .js 上点击鼠标右键》新建》项,名称为:OpenWithProgids aJh无知

image.pngaJh无知

然后选中新建的 OpenWithProgids 项,在右侧空白处点击鼠标右键》字符串值,名称设置为:JSFileaJh无知

然后找到 HKEY_CLASSES_ROOT\JSFile,在这下面有 Shell 项,再创建对应的菜单项就可以了。aJh无知

image.pngaJh无知


aJh无知


aJh无知


aJh无知

本文由 微wx笑 创作,采用 署名-非商业性使用-相同方式共享 4.0 许可协议,转载请附上原文出处链接及本声明。
原文链接:https://www.ivu4e.com/blog/system/2023-01-23/1676.html

很赞哦! () 有话说 ()